3 million euro investment for recalm

Hamburg, 24 March 2025

recalm, has raised over 3 million euros in a successful Series A financing round. The investment comes from IBG Venture Capital Fund IV, which is managed by bmp Ventures AG, SymbiaVC - the investment arm of Barbara Peifer Privatstiftung - and existing investors such as Silvercrown Capital SE, the VC arm of Bernard Krone Holding SE & Co. KG and GREENEERING INVEST AG.

Revolutionary audio and communication solutions in driver's cabs
 

The start-up from Hamburg University of Technology develops advanced audio and communication solutions for machine and vehicle cabins. With their patented ANCOR technology, they actively reduce noise pollution and optimise communication in driver's cabs. As a result, they not only improve the comfort and efficiency of machine operators, but also help to optimise work processes in the industry.

The team intends to use this fresh capital to further advance its vision of transforming noise into sound. The plan is to set up its own production site in Barleben near Magdeburg, where purchasing, production and logistics will be bundled on 800 square metres. At the same time, Hamburg will remain the centre of research and development for the innovative ANCOR technology - the basis for the continuous improvement of the recalm software solution.

As part of the expansion, the existing product portfolio will be extended to include the ANCOR Custom 2026 cab integration solution. This solution will be launched on the market together with leading construction and agricultural machinery manufacturers, such as Maschinenfabrik Bernard Krone GmbH, in order to meet the growing demand for optimised audio and communication systems in driver cabs.

With this investment, recalm is strengthening its position as a leading provider of audio and communication solutions in driver cabs. In addition to the fresh capital, the company also benefits from extensive industry expertise and strategic networks that pave the way for scaled series production and further business development.
